Due to the drastic changes of soci-economy (population growth, urbanizations, etc.) and the increasing severity of the mpact of climate change (watere extremes), the adequate water resources management has been put of great importance in many parts of the world.
In addition, water-related disaster risk reduction against floods and droughts is also becoming urgent issues to be tackled with to achieve the sustanable and resilient society of the future.
In order to address the integrated water resources management and the water-related disaster risk reduction, especially under the constrained situation of COVID-19 panddemic and its post era, this session tries to highlight some good examples and case studies as well as the lessons learnt for the improvement of the water resoureces management and water-related disasters risk reduction around the world, and deliver the key messages for the achievement of SDGs, Sendai Framework DRR, and Paris Agreement toward 2030.
